Udenyca (pegfilgrastim-cbqv injection)
type of Hematopoietic Growth Factors
Udenyca (pegfilgrastim-cbqv) is a leukocyte growth factor indicated to decrease the incidence of infection, as manifested by febrile neutropenia, in patients with non-myeloid malignancies receiving myelosuppressive anti-cancer drugs associated with a clinically significant incidence of febrile neutropenia.
